Many players have encountered the error code 0x1 when they try to play Minecraft. For instance, one such player said this in a Reddit post, “Is anyone able to help with this issue? I get this error [0x1] when trying to boot the [Minecraft] launcher normally.” Consequently, players can’t play Minecraft when the launcher throws up that error. These are some ways you can fix the Minecraft error code 0x1 on a Windows PC.
End Minecraft Launcher Background Task
First, try ending the Minecraft Launcher background process in Task Manager. Applying this troubleshooting method might close a frozen Minecraft Launcher process. This is how you can end the ML background task:
- Right-click the taskbar and open Task Manager.
- Next, look for the Minecraft Launcher background task in the Processes tab.
- Right-click the Minecraft Launcher process to select End task.
- Try starting the Minecraft Launcher again.
Run the Minecraft Launcher With Admin Rights
Players confirm they’ve fixed the Minecraft error code 0x1 by running the launcher with admin rights. Applying this possible fix grants the software elevated privileges for accessing and modifying files and settings. This is how you can run the Minecraft Launcher with administrator rights.
- First, activate the file finder by clicking on the taskbar’s Search box.
- Enter Minecraft Launcher in the Search box.
- Right-click the Minecraft Launcher search result to select Run as administrator.

Update Graphics Driver
An outmoded graphics driver on your PC might be causing Minecraft error code 0x1. New Minecraft versions require specific OpenGL versions that an outmoded GPU driver might not support. So, try updating your PC’s graphics driver as covered on this KeenGamer page.
Reinstall the Minecraft Launcher
Some players also confirm they’ve fixed the Minecraft error code 0x1 by reinstalling the game. So, try reinstalling the Minecraft Launcher if other potential fixes don’t work for you. You can reinstall Minecraft Launcher like this:
- Press the Windows logo key + I to bring up the Settings window.
- Click Apps > Installed apps within Settings.
- Next, click the menu button for the Minecraft Launcher app and select Uninstall.
- Restart Windows after uninstalling.
- Open the Microsoft Store from the Start menu.
- Enter Minecraft Launcher in the MS Store’s search box.
- Click the Minecraft Launcher search result.
- Press the Get button for the app.
